Should the Terrorist Identities Datamart Environment (TIDE) database be linked to airline passenger lists so that individuals on that list could be thoroughly checked before boarding flights?

The embassy sent a cable to Washington, which resulted in Mr. Abdulmutallab’s name being entered in a database of 550,000 people with possible ties to terrorism. But he was not put on the much smaller no-fly list of 4,000 people or on a list of 14,000 people who are required to undergo additional screening before flying, nor was his multiple-entry visa to the United States revoked.
